We are looking for a Landing Gear System Engineer to join our team in Filton. As a Landing Gear System Engineer, you will be responsible for monitoring in-service occurrences of one or more A/C programs for ATA32 (Landing Gear). You will participate in collaboration with different Airbus safety stakeholders (Airworthiness, Design Office, Customer Support, Chief Engineering) in the following activities:
- Review and severity identification of in-service events in the fleet;
- Manage any unsafe condition related to landing gear systems occurring in the fleet;
- Analysis and monitoring of the implementation of proposed corrective actions;
- You will also have to communicate the progress of activities to your Project Manager.
Requirements:
- University degree in Engineering;
- At least 5 years experience in Aeronautical or Aerospace Engineering, ideally in the field of Safety and Continued Airworthiness engineering;
- Experience of Safety processes, regulations and guidelines (ARP 5150 (Safety Assessment of Commercial Airplanes), Part-21A);
- Good knowledge of Aircraft Systems, in particular, Landing Gear and Hydraulic Systems;
- Track record of leading complex projects involving multiple stakeholders and staff members, with delivery to Time, Cost and Quality;
- This job requires an awareness of any potential compliance risks and a commitment to act with integrity, as the foundation for the Company’s success;
- Strong ability to lead and manage a project team;
- Fluent in English (verbal and written).
